Transaction 84dd21c2b7d08e93538be1165eecd34dc52a042b2324c78ffadada4f44b61eaa
1 Input
1 Output
-
84dd21c2b7d08e93538be1165eecd34dc52a042b2324c78ffadada4f44b61eaa:0
- value
- 3036352
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c9535b636d8462a9070647e00140ea2e47957d69 OP_EQUAL
- address
- 3L3Xbr4AScDLBTQqUMA6neVwNeQFWWQNqu